UP Urban Development & Energy Minister AK Sharma is in a lot of discussion about his style of working now a days. On Saturday, AK Sharma himself inspected the cleanliness system in the state capital Lucknow. He personally investigated and interacted with the people by visiting Butler Chauraha, Vijayant Khand Gomti Nagar and Indira Nagar Sector-11 in dengue affected areas. People are also positively convinced of the efforts being made by the Energy Minister.
Urban Development and Energy Minister AK Sharma interacted with the local citizens and inquired about the actual circumstances of dengue outbreak. Sharma instructed to continue the work of cleaning of drains along with the drains belonging to the main roads in the urban areas. He directed to keep spraying anti-larva and fogging as before to prevent communicable diseases and to save the lives of citizens from mosquito-borne diseases, dengue, chikungunya.
During his visit, Minister AK Sharma also met dengue affected patients and their families. At the same time, he directed the officials to go out on the ground inspection and provide direct benefits of the schemes to the people. All officers should take immediate cognizance of the complaints of citizens, any kind of laxity, hesitant and avoidant mentality will not be acceptable, instructs the minister.
